What Is City Holder?

City Holder is a Telegram-based GameFi experience in which players build and manage a virtual city while earning in-game rewards through daily activities.

The platform provides several ways to collect coins, including Daily Combo challenges, Daily Quizzes, referral rewards and special events. Completing both daily activities can provide up to 7.5 million coins per day, which can be used within the game for activities such as upgrading buildings, unlocking districts and expanding the virtual city.

The coins currently function as in-game rewards. Any future real-world utility, including a potential token launch or airdrop, depends on official announcements.

Security Reminders for Players

City Holder participants should use the official Telegram mini app when submitting daily codes and quiz answers.

Players should not purchase supposedly guaranteed codes or answers from unofficial sources, share Telegram login information, or disclose wallet recovery phrases and private keys. They should also avoid connecting wallets to unknown websites or Telegram groups promising additional rewards.

A legitimate platform should not require users to provide private keys or recovery phrases. Requests for such information should be treated as potential fraud.
